Since AS opened, there has been a ton of discussion on which chat to use, with each one carrying their own quirks, awesome traits, and not so awesome traits. After a lot of research, I've narrowed it down to two that has *almost* everything we need, or would like, in a chat service, and have decided to leave the final choice up to membership vote. I've included information below on both of the chat services so you are able to make an informed decision on both.

Chatango:
The Good:
:Auto refresh
:Avatars
:Guests can join the conversation
:Members can manipulate color and font of text
:It is available on every page of the forum
:If a highly disruptive member or guest breaks chatbox rules through harassment, mentioning of explicit body parts, etc... that member can be banned from the chat exclusively, leaving the rest of the site open for their enjoyment.
:Auto-refresh, with a list of who is online inside the chatbox itself

The Bad:
:It crashes. A lot.
:Through their Chatango account, members can get spam/inappropriate material sent to them (this happens to me a lot)
:Stalking through the Chatango account (this happens to me, too)
:Users have to have a Chatango account to fully access Chatango abilities, such as a username and avatar

MiniChat
The Good:
:Avatar usage
:It doesn't crash!
:Guests can chat
:If a highly disruptive member or guest breaks chatbox rules through harassment, mentioning of explicit body parts, etc... that member can be banned from the chat exclusively, leaving the rest of the site open for their enjoyment
:Users do not need a special chat account, just a membership on AS.
:Auto-refresh, with a list of members who have chatted in the last hour both in the chat, and on the footer of the index

The Bad:
:Only available on the index. But, if you're like most of us, you have multiple windows open anyway ^^
:No fun manipulation of text colors/fonts
